Ouvrir classeur avec une macro

Résolu/Fermé
Bonisam Messages postés 144 Date d'inscription mercredi 27 octobre 2010 Statut Membre Dernière intervention 24 avril 2019 - 8 août 2011 à 18:00
Bonisam Messages postés 144 Date d'inscription mercredi 27 octobre 2010 Statut Membre Dernière intervention 24 avril 2019 - 9 août 2011 à 13:56
Bonjour,

J'ai petit hic. j'ai crée deux classeurs de donnée. j'aimerais dans le premier classeur insérer une macro qui me permet d'ouvrir directement le second. Est ce possible? si oui comment puisse faire ça?
Merci pour votre contribution.
Mes respects
Bonisam

2 réponses

pijaku Messages postés 12263 Date d'inscription jeudi 15 mai 2008 Statut Modérateur Dernière intervention 4 janvier 2024 2 752
Modifié par pijaku le 9/08/2011 à 08:07
Bonjour,
1- ouvrir le classeur 1
2- ALT+F11
3- Insertion/Module
4- Copiez-collez ce code dans le module VBA créé :
Sub OuvrirClasseur2() 
Workbooks.Open Filename:="C:\CheminDeVotreFicher\Classeur2.xls" 
End Sub

5- adaptez ce code à votre situation (nom du fichier, chemin d'accès)
6- Fermez l'éditeur visual basic
7- depuis votre classeur 1 tapez ALT+F8, choisir "OuvrirClasseur2" et cliquez sur exécuter.

Cordialement,
Franck P
0
Morgothal Messages postés 1236 Date d'inscription jeudi 22 avril 2010 Statut Membre Dernière intervention 19 mai 2015 183
9 août 2011 à 12:23
Ou même insérer un bouton, auquel on peut affecter cette macro, suivant cette manip :
https://forums.commentcamarche.net/forum/affich-22832085-macrocommande
0